词源
From Middle English gobben (“to drink or swallow greedily”), of uncertain origin + -le (frequentative suffix). Middle English gobben is perhaps an alteration of Middle English globben (“to gulp down”), related to English gulpen (“to gulp”). However, compare also French gober.
